Output 11c4f00205d74076645edb6c88cf3dcecbb9236dd94e863d14e27cf492281631:1

value
2537918118
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18d4165078fb6cb475f8b2f394eb68b01b233dd2 OP_EQUALVERIFY OP_CHECKSIG
address
13GHHgMZ8nd59WdowtjMky64xUkUSqS3cr
transaction
11c4f00205d74076645edb6c88cf3dcecbb9236dd94e863d14e27cf492281631
confirmations
742510
spent
true